Latest Patents

William Corlett holds a patent for "Long duration asynchronous transaction monitoring of distributed systems." This invention encompasses a system, method, and computer-readable medium designed for performing data center management and monitoring operations. The process includes identifying a plurality of transaction components within a data center, monitoring these components, identifying long duration transactions based on the monitoring, and generating insights regarding these transactions.
